Power BI Create Date Hierarchy: Organize Your Dates!

3 min read 25-10-2024
Power BI Create Date Hierarchy: Organize Your Dates!

Table of Contents :

Power BI is a powerful business analytics tool that enables you to visualize your data and share insights across your organization. One of the critical features of Power BI is its ability to create a Date Hierarchy, which allows you to manage and analyze dates effectively. This capability is essential for performing time-based analysis and reporting. In this guide, we will delve into how to create a Date Hierarchy in Power BI, enhancing your data visualization and making your reports more dynamic and informative. đź“…

What is Date Hierarchy in Power BI?

A Date Hierarchy in Power BI is a structured organization of dates that allows users to break down time data into levels such as Year, Quarter, Month, and Day. This hierarchical arrangement aids users in drilling down or rolling up data for various timeframes, enhancing the analytical experience. đź“Š

Importance of Using Date Hierarchy

Enhanced Data Analysis 🔍

By organizing your dates into a hierarchy, you can quickly analyze trends over time. For example, you can easily compare monthly sales over several years, understand seasonal trends, or identify yearly growth rates.

Simplified Reporting đź“ť

Date Hierarchies make reporting much more straightforward. Rather than scrolling through all your dates, you can collapse or expand specific time periods, making the data easier to read and interpret.

Improved User Experience đź‘Ť

When presenting data to stakeholders, a well-structured Date Hierarchy allows users to interactively explore the data, gaining insights without feeling overwhelmed by raw numbers.

How to Create a Date Hierarchy in Power BI

Creating a Date Hierarchy in Power BI is a simple process. Follow these steps to enhance your data analysis capabilities:

Step 1: Load Your Data

Before creating a Date Hierarchy, ensure that your data is loaded into Power BI. You will typically have a date column that you want to use for the hierarchy.

Step 2: Select Your Date Column

  1. In the Data view, locate your date column within your dataset.
  2. Click on the date column header to select it.

Step 3: Create a New Hierarchy

  1. In the ribbon at the top, under the “Modeling” tab, you’ll find the “New Hierarchy” option.
  2. Click on “New Hierarchy”, and a new hierarchy will be created.

Step 4: Add Date Levels to the Hierarchy

  1. Drag your date column to the newly created hierarchy.
  2. Next, you can add additional levels, such as Year, Quarter, Month, and Day by using DAX functions or by creating calculated columns.

Here’s a simple example table to illustrate the process:

Level Function
Year YEAR(Date)
Quarter QUARTER(Date)
Month FORMAT(Date, "MMMM")
Day DAY(Date)

Step 5: Visualize Your Data

Once your Date Hierarchy is set up, you can drag it onto your reports. You can use it in various visualizations like line charts, bar charts, and tables, enabling you to analyze the data in different ways.

Tips for Optimizing Date Hierarchy Usage

Consistency is Key 🔑

Ensure that your date format is consistent throughout your data model. Inconsistent formats can lead to errors in the hierarchy and incorrect analysis.

Leverage Filters and Slicers

Utilize filters and slicers in your reports. This will allow users to narrow down their view by specific time periods, enhancing the interactivity of your reports.

Use DAX for Custom Calculations

Power BI allows for advanced calculations using DAX (Data Analysis Expressions). Consider creating custom measures that leverage your Date Hierarchy for more advanced analytics.

Important Note: Always ensure your dataset has a proper date dimension. Creating a dedicated date table is often recommended for more complex models.

Common Challenges When Creating a Date Hierarchy

While creating a Date Hierarchy in Power BI is straightforward, some common challenges may arise:

Missing Dates

If your dataset has missing dates, your hierarchy will not function correctly. Ensure your data is complete.

Time Zone Issues

Be cautious of time zone differences, especially if your data is coming from different geographical locations. This could affect your date analysis.

Overlapping Periods

Ensure that your date levels do not overlap, as this can cause confusion in reports.

Conclusion

By effectively creating a Date Hierarchy in Power BI, you can significantly enhance your data visualization capabilities. Whether you’re tracking sales performance, monitoring user engagement, or analyzing seasonal trends, a structured Date Hierarchy will allow you to derive meaningful insights from your data. With the tips and steps outlined in this guide, you will be well on your way to mastering date analysis in Power BI. 🌟

Using this structured approach, you will be able to present data more clearly and make informed decisions based on your analysis. Power BI is indeed a robust tool, and leveraging features like the Date Hierarchy can make a considerable difference in how you interpret and use your data. Happy analyzing!